ASTM A179 Carbon Steel Fin Tube Extruded Type With Al1060 For Air Cooled Chiller

 

Product Overview
The extruded fin tube is manufactured by inserting a carbon steel seamless tube (ASTM A179) into a pure aluminium Al1060 sleeve, followed by a high-pressure extrusion process that forms integral fins from the aluminium sleeve. This method ensures a perfect metallurgical bond between fins and tube, eliminating air gaps and providing maximum thermal conductivity.

 

Chemical Composition of ASTM A179 (Base Tube)

Element C Mn P (max) S (max)
Content (%) ≤ 0.06 0.27–0.63 ≤ 0.035 ≤ 0.035

Mechanical Properties of ASTM A179

Property Requirement
Tensile Strength ≥ 325 MPa
Yield Strength ≥ 180 MPa
Elongation ≥ 35%
Hardness ≤ 72 HRB

 

Advantages

  • Superior heat transfer efficiency due to firm aluminium-to-steel bonding.

  • Lightweight and high conductivity of Al1060 provides excellent thermal performance.

  • Corrosion protection → Aluminium fins shield the carbon steel tube from environmental damage.

  • Durability → Withstands vibration, thermal cycling, and long service periods.

  • Cost-effective → Combines low-cost carbon steel tubing with high-conductivity aluminium fins

Applications in Air Cooled Chiller

  • Air cooled chillers in HVAC and industrial cooling systems

  • Air cooled condensers in power plants and chemical plants

  • Process gas coolers in petrochemical industries

  • Cooling sections in refinery air coolers and compressor stations
